Raising Little Gobblers : The Complete Guide

Successfully raising for small turkeys, often called babies, can be rewarding , but requires dedication and specific attention to their where to buy small turkey well-being. At first , providing a draft-free brooder area is essential , maintaining a heat of around 95°F (35°C) for the initial week, slowly decreasing it by 5 degrees each period thereafter. Proper feeding is equally important , with grower turkey rations offered continuously in shallow containers. Clean moisture must always be available , and protection from threats like foxes and birds is entirely imperative for their existence .

Identifying Your Wild Turkey – Rooster vs. Female Traits

Determining if you’re observing a male or a female turkey can be surprisingly straightforward with a small attention to detail. Roosters generally display significantly greater size and vibrant feathers, often including a brilliant iridescent copper sheen on their top. They also possess a noticeable beard, a long cluster of altered feathers on their chest . Females , on the contrary hand, are generally smaller in size, with more muted brown plumage and lack a beard altogether. In addition, listen for the characteristic gobbling sound, which is primarily made by the males .
